Example Chart
Lady with Bone Marrow Disease
Data: August 5, 1951, 2:37 AM IST, Repalle (80°51'E, 16°1'N)
Lagna: Gemini (2°48')
Moon: 10°17' Leo
Issue: Bedridden ~4 months; bone marrow/blood cancer diagnosis; seeking bone marrow transplant donor
Special Dasha: Kshetraja/Ketusita Sama Dasha
Condition: 10th lord in 10th house → Kshetraja/Ketusita Sama Dasha applies per Parashara.
— PVNR"When the 10th lord is in the 10th house, Parashara recommended this conditional dasha. It takes precedence over regular Vimshottari."
Current dasha: Saturn Mahadasha
- Saturn = 8th + 9th lord for Gemini; not just malefic but also 9th lord
- A6 (Arudha of 6th = manifested disease) in Saturn's sign = Saturn is lord of A6
- Saturn in 4th house = not strong for Saturn (best in 3rd/6th/11th)
- Mars Antardasha (current): Mars = 6th+11th lord in lagna = 6th lord afflicting the body directly
- Mars in Aisha (weapon) drekana = severe harm to body
- Combined: Saturn (8th lord, A6 lord) + Mars (6th lord in lagna) = disease erupting now
Mercury Antardasha (next):
- Mercury = lagna lord (Gemini); in Cancer in D6; 3rd+6th lord in D6
- "Lagna lord never wants to harm the person — he is the greatest well-wisher of the physical body"
- In D6: Mercury as 3rd+6th lord = fight-back, recovery procedures (not good health, but fighting disease)
- Mercury in Cancer (sattvic, fruitful sign) = easier to give good results; friend of Rahu/Ketu (better negotiation)
- Prediction: Some recovery in Mercury antardasha; not complete recovery; she will get "a new lease on life" — donor found, procedure proceeds, some comfort. But not fully well.
D6 Analysis
Key principle (D6):
— PVNR"Lagna lord in D6 does NOT give protection. It shows the SELF from the point of view of disease. In D6, lagna lord being strong means he is actively participating in the disease experience — not protecting you."
- Compare: D1 lagna lord = protects body; D6 lagna lord = shows how disease manifests
- Similarly: D10 lagna lord = shows self in professional context; D9 lagna lord = shows self in marital context
D6 chart: Saturn = Bhadaka lord in 8th house (Scorpio in D6 with Aries lagna D6) = troublemaker in house of long suffering; Mars = LL+8th lord in 6th house = disease house. Both dashas badly placed in D6 = serious disease confirmed.
Maraka and Longevity Assessment
Shoola Dasha: Sagittarius (current) = 3rd from AL, no serious afflictions = potential but not immediate death Next Shoola: Capricorn = 8th from lagna, aspected by Saturn-Mars evil combination = more dangerous
Chitra/Nakshatra Dasha:
- Saturn dasha = 8th lord (more disease-giving than killing)
- Mars antardasha = NOT a killer (6th+11th lord, not 2nd/7th)
- Mercury = NOT a killer
Greatest danger:
- Jupiter = 7th lord in 10th = killer (but in own house; not this dasha)
- Sun = 3rd lord in 2nd (Maraka position) = "killer, period"; Sun dasha comes 2014–2017
- "Once Sun dasha begins, very difficult to save. Sun-Moon and Sun-Sun are the most dangerous sub-periods. 2014 May to 2017 October = grave danger."
Conclusion: She will not die in current Saturn dasha. Will suffer and be in hospital but will live. Real danger is Sun dasha in 2014.
Remedies
Narasimha mantra (ugram viram mahavishnum — 32 syllables):
- Covers both Mercury (Vishnu avatar) AND Mars (fierce form of Vishnu, lion-man)
- Strengthens Mercury (lagna lord, greatest benefactor) and appeals to Mars in a Vaishnava context
- Mars is in Mercury sign (Virgo) in both Rasi and D6 = Mars-Mercury relationship highlighted
- Do 1 hour daily; parent/family on her behalf with sincere devotion and focus on her recovery
Key Principles from This Lesson
Rasi Sandhi / Balayavastha
Planet at 0°–1° of any sign = in Rasi Sandhi = Balayavastha = "deep infancy"
- Very weak; unable to give its results fully
- Different from Gandanta (which is specifically the water-fire junction at end/beginning of signs in Cancer-Leo, Scorpio-Sagittarius, Pisces-Aries nakshatras)
Badhakasthana by Lagna Type
| Lagna type | Badhakasthana |
|---|---|
| Movable (Chara): Aries, Cancer, Libra, Capricorn | 11th house |
| Fixed (Sthira): Taurus, Leo, Scorpio, Aquarius | 9th house |
| Dual (Dwiswabhava): Gemini, Virgo, Sagittarius, Pisces | 7th house |
Badhakesha = lord of Badhakasthana = planet that creates obstacles/blockages
Mandi and Gulika
— PVNR"Mandi and Gulika are the two sons of Saturn. They are sub-planets, upagrahas, and they are more evil than Saturn himself. Their placement in any house or with any planet shows severe affliction from shadow forces."
- Particularly bad in 5th house (intelligence/learning)
- Their dispositor's placement is also relevant
D6 Lagna Lord Rule
In any divisional chart, the lagna lord shows the "self" from that chart's perspective — NOT always protection:
- D1: Lagna lord = protects physical body
- D6: Lagna lord = self from disease perspective; can give disease
- D24: Lagna lord = self from learning perspective; afflicted = learning difficulty
- D10: Lagna lord = self from career perspective
Afflictions in D30 — Sign Quality
| Sign ruled by | Result of affliction in D30 |
|---|---|
| Jupiter/Venus/Mercury (benefics) | Easier to overcome; milder in effect |
| Mars/Saturn (malefics) | Harder to overcome; more severe in effect |
Prasna Rules
- Jupiter in lagna OR aspecting lagna/lagna lord = prasna is genuine, stars willing to answer
- Navamsa lagna matching the person's natal chart (same as natal lagna, or sign of natal LL, etc.) = additional confirmation stars are answering
- If neither: skip the prasna, it won't give reliable answers
- Drekkana (D3) in prasna = future (Navamsa = past; Rashi = present)
Vastu (Brief)
- Vastu mandala: 9×9 grid of 81 squares each ruled by a deity; door in auspicious deity's zone = good
- Directions: South = Mars (fire, fighting); West = Saturn; Southwest = Niriti (negative/underground)
- Kitchen: Southeast (Agni direction) = traditional + auspicious; Southwest = negative energy in food
- Master bedroom: Southeast = fire = quarrels; should be away from fire direction
- Every direction has good and bad interpretations; rules may need chart-based modification
